Transaction df8065784617a1a3641bf8a0bfb5f4314baf0274e9852d9e50aa5b178ea4cc1c
1 Input
2 Outputs
- df8065784617a1a3641bf8a0bfb5f4314baf0274e9852d9e50aa5b178ea4cc1c:0
- df8065784617a1a3641bf8a0bfb5f4314baf0274e9852d9e50aa5b178ea4cc1c:1
value 1039569
address 1MGefGihSDbj9GwRtSqeSEUBtZ6hr9sSVr
value 1258944287
address 1BEW3suit5oNjzUcmSWqk2akxpARuqtp2S